ADRV9001 EXAMPLE USE CASES
The intention of this section is to provide the reader with the overall idea how ADRV9001 integrated transceiver can operate as an RF
front end in different applications. The provided list is not exhaustive, and there are other applications in which the ADRV9001 can serve.
Each example is accompanied with a table that explains the main limitations and highlights what the customer should look for when
implementing the ADRV9001 in the end application.
ADRV9001 IN A SINGLE-BAND 2RT2R FDD TYPE SMALL-CELL APPLICATION
Figure 3. ADRV9001 in Single-Band 2T2R FDD Type Small Cell Application
With a minimum number of external components, the ADRV9001 transceiver can be used to build complete RF to bits signal chains that
can serve as the RF front end in small cell type applications. The ADRV9001 dual Rx and Tx signal chains allow the user to implement
MIMO or diversity in their system. The ADRV9001 internal AGC can be used to autonomously monitor and set appropriate gain levels
for Rx signal chains. For non-time critical FDD type applications, control of the ADRV9001 TRx can be done through API commands
that use the SPI interface.
